Probably the easiest thing I ever made...

Take 6 foam tennis balls, drill a small hole in the top and glue in a piece of string leaving about 3 inches trailing out of the top.

Mix up a small container (big enough to submerge your balls) of latex with black or anthracite acrylic paint.

Dip the balls/bombs one at a time then hang them by their strings to dry for 12-24 hours, repeat the dippnig process 5-10 times. The more dippings the heavier they will get and the further they will fly.
